Understanding the Core Mechanics of the Chicken Road Game
At its heart, the chicken road game is incredibly simple to understand. A cartoon chicken begins its journey on a road filled with squares, each representing a potential multiplier. The player clicks or taps to move the chicken forward one square at a time. With each step, the multiplier increases, boosting the potential winnings. However, hidden amongst the multipliers are traps – pitfalls that will end the game and forfeit any accumulated winnings. The core challenge lies in knowing when to stop. Push your luck too far, and you risk losing everything; stop too soon, and you miss out on a potentially larger payout.
Effective gameplay requires a balance between boldness and caution. Many players employ strategies like setting a target multiplier and stopping when it’s reached, or establishing a maximum risk level they are willing to accept. Learning to manage the escalating tension and resist the temptation of ever-increasing rewards is key to success. The Psychological Elements at Play
The chicken road game isn’t just about luck; it’s a fascinating study in human psychology. The escalating multiplier creates a powerful sense of anticipation and excitement, while the looming threat of a trap induces anxiety. This combination triggers a loop of risk assessment and decision-making, heavily influenced by cognitive biases and emotional states. Players often fall prey to the “gambler’s fallacy,” believing that a trap is “due” after a series of safe steps, or the “loss aversion” bias, feeling the pain of a potential loss more acutely than the pleasure of a potential win.
Understanding these psychological tendencies can help players make more rational decisions. Recognizing when anxiety is clouding judgment or when the allure of a big win is leading to reckless behavior is crucial for minimizing losses and maximizing enjoyment. The game’s simplicity allows players to focus intensely on these internal battles, making it a surprisingly mentally stimulating experience.

Comparing the Chicken Road Game to Traditional Gambling
The chicken road game shares similarities with traditional gambling activities, primarily its core mechanic of risk versus reward. However, it also differs in several key aspects. Unlike casino games which often pit players against the house with a predetermined house edge, the chicken road game appears more random, lacking a clearly defined statistical advantage for the game provider. This perceived fairness contributes to its popularity, particularly among players wary of traditional casinos. Furthermore, the game’s rapid gameplay and low stakes often make it a more accessible and less financially risky form of entertainment.
However, it’s important to acknowledge that the chicken road game, like all forms of gambling, carries the potential for addiction. The thrill of the win and the quick pace can be highly addictive, leading to impulsive behavior and financial difficulties – therefore responsible playing should be prioritised before ever playing.
